We are seeking a Manager, Business Development (M&A) to join our Firm. This position will be based in our Washington D.C. office (hybrid). The Business Development Manager (M&A) collaborates with the Senior Manager, Business Development (M&A) to support strategic plans and objectives for our M&A and Corporate practices. This BDM drives cross-practice collaboration and serves as a resource assisting with related communications, administration, research and reporting, marketing communications, coordination of projects, and leads implementation efforts of partner pipelines to ensure successful growth and consistency regarding the Firm’s key business initiatives.
Implements proactive, organized marketing and business development initiatives for select transactional practices, including client targeting programs and pursuit teams for target markets. Drafts and prepares high quality pitches, capability statements, placemats and BD presentations, working closely with relevant partners, AD, and supported by a BDM Coordinator, where relevant. Takes ownership for pitch/presentation content, drafting tailored copy to convey Skadden's credentials, its differentiators, and its value proposition to potential clients. Understands the sales cycle and advises attorneys on lead development, pitching, and follow-up. Manages sales pipeline processes for assigned practices and partners across regions. Oversees collection of practice experience for the Firm’s database to ensure accurate profiling. Identifies and supports cross-practice and cross-region opportunities, collaborating with attorneys and marketing to align strategies, measure target progress, and leverage those opportunities to drive overall business development plans.
Works with AD to implement strategic plans for practice segments, execute tactics, report progress, and align resources. Collaborates with Strategic Intelligence to prepare briefings and research for attorneys in preparation for events and meetings.
Drives tactics and programs that raise the practices’ internal and external visibility and positioning in key markets through speaking events, sponsorships, PR (with global PR team), and social media. Manages legal directory, award, and ranking opportunities, leading the drafting of practice submissions. Evaluates profile-raising opportunities, ensuring maximum benefit from sponsorships and speaking engagements. Monitors industry trends and collaborates with attorneys and the editorial team on related client mailings and articles.
Leads strategic planning and execution of client events and speaking engagements in collaboration with Global Events team. Analyzes attendee lists and prepares tailored materials to enhance engagement. Supports attorney follow-up and tracks outcomes and activities in the Firm’s CRM to ensure effective event management and client interaction.
Manages Firm resources responsibly. Provides direction and oversight to direct report(s), monitoring performance and providing regular feedback. Participates in the interviewing, selection and training process.
Bachelor's degree Minimum of seven years of business development and marketing experience in a law firm
